Job summary

Are you looking for a career in the NHS? We are looking for an enthusiastic and friendly individual to join our hardworking MPP administration team!

You will be joining our team in Southampton as an MPP Admin Supervisor and you will work closely with our MPP Admin & Business Manager to lead and motivate our teams to provide a quality service to our clinical colleagues.

As an Admin Supervisor, you will be responsible in ensuring the service is running smoothly and be able to provide relevant training and advice to the team. You will work closely with the MPP Admin Management team to ensure that all departments within the unit are appropriately supported.

We are looking for a well organised individual with good communication and keyboard skills, a good standard of literacy and numeracy with an ability to maintain accurate records. You will be required to liaise with patients, clinicians, staff and other agencies to ensure the smooth running of the service and appointment systems.

Experience in the use of Microsoft Office, Excel, Word and Outlook is essential and training will be given in the use of SystmOne, which is the clinical software system used by the service.

Main duties of the job

Manage & supervise use of electronic record system (System One) ensuring accurate information regarding child health records, to include scanning/uploading information in a timely manner, including data cleansing & reporting as required

Supervise & overview systems/databases

Input & retrieve statistical information from relevant electronic records system, analysing & converting the information into appropriate formats & reports

Supervise admin staff liaising by telephone or in person with clients & other healthcare professionals, promoting good judgement to identify requirements in order to pass on information correctly or take appropriate action

Carry out audits of competencies

Alert the line manager of any potential breaches in relation to Information Governance & timescales for processing referrals

Supervise the reporting of defective equipment or health & safety issues, without delay to your line manager & in accordance with Trust requirements, taking responsibility for your own office environment & supervising staff within your team with this process

Resolve & mitigate any practice breaches in agreed Service Admin systems alerting line manager once options are exhausted

Act on suggestions made in relation to improving systems/processes implementing agreed changes & escalating good practice ideas & unresolved system issues

Undertake internal change projects to address ineffective practices identified

Disclosure and Barring Service Check

This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.
